The most useful of all of the command line switches, IMO, was -p. I used it to configure the development environment with a simple .PRG containing OKL commands to perform various tasks I do often: open the project, build the project, execute the project, add a program header, etc. -P was an essential part of my favorite productivity tool and I haven't found a suitable replacement. It's annoying to type "DO .." dozens of times day. (And yes, I've just now decided to complain about it <g>.) Does anyone know why this switch was removed? Does anyone else miss it? Do you have a work around?
